Cherry Chocolate Margarita (adapted from Food and Wine)
Ingredients
1 teaspoon each of cocoa powder and sugar, pinch of salt
3 ounces lime juice
5-6 cherries and some cherry juice if using bottled (I used Trader Joes Morello cherries)
3 ounces tequila
2 ounces Cointreau
1 ounce agave syrup
Directions:

  1. Combine the cocoa, sugar and salt in a small dish.  
  2. Rub the rim of  a glass with lime, rub in the cocoa mixture to coat the rim.
  3. Combine the lime juice and cherries and cherry juice in a cocktail shaker and muddle the cherries a bit.
  4. Add the other ingredients to a cocktail shaker along with some ice.  Shake vigorously and pour into rimmed glass.
